iCOP 2.0 - AI-based advances for law enforcement’s response to online child sexual exploitation and abuse in southeast Asia

Project Details

Description

The project is developing new AI technology for automatically detecting new or previously unknown online child sexual abuse media from Southeast Asia in peer-to-peer file sharing networks. Awareness raising and training activities are also provided for law enforcement agencies in the region.
Tis project is funded though the End Violence Against Children Fund (UNICEF).
